The courts have generally held that direct taxes are restricted to taxes on people (variously called capitation, poll tax or head tax) and property. (Penn Mutual Indemnity Company. v. C.I.R., 227 F.2d 16, 19-20 (3rd Cir. 1960).) All the taxes are commonly referred to as "indirect taxes," because they tax an event, rather than somebody or property by itself. (Steward Machine Co. v. Davis, 301 U.S. 548, 581-582 (1937).)
